Buying Ammo from Winfield: the Rules

Indiana keeps ammunition simple for Winfield buyers: no FOID, no permit, no logbook — a valid photo ID and federal age rules (18+ for long-gun ammo, 21+ for handgun ammo) are the entire checklist. Walk in with your appointment, walk out with your calibers, be back past Winfield Town Park before the range fills up.

Price talk, no games: 9mm FMJ is the market's bellwether and we price it to be bought by the case, not the box. Defensive loads carry real R&D and are worth paying for — once, to fill your carry mags — while the third tier of boutique "tactical" ammo is mostly branding. We will point at the difference on the shelf.

Ammunition Questions from Winfield

What ID does an Indiana buyer need for ammunition?

A valid government photo ID, and that is it — Indiana requires no FOID or permit for ammunition. Federal age rules apply: 18+ for rifle and shotgun ammunition, 21+ for handgun ammunition. Winfield buyers are typically in and out in under ten minutes.

Can you order specialty or bulk ammunition for Winfield shooters?

Yes — case-quantity range ammo, defensive loads by the box, hunting calibers in season, and oddballs the chains dropped. Distributor stock usually lands here within a week, and bulk pricing is quoted up front so you can compare against any online cart honestly.

Is your ammo pricing competitive with online sellers?

Compare landed costs: online ammo adds shipping (heavy!), card fees, and days of waiting. Our counter price is the complete price, available same-day, roughly 25–35 minutes from Winfield — for most calibers the honest gap is smaller than the banners claim.
